Make yourself a unique watch

If you find buying a new watch tedious, because you can't find a style you like, don't worry: you can make one that it unique and personally designed by you. Sounds expensive, doesn't it? It isn't; all you need to do is get hold of a watch face with two small hoops or hooks, and make a strap out of beads, or wire, or ribbon, or anything else you fancy.

There is a big trend at the moment for textile/fabric combinations, so you could choose some ribbon, or a faux suede strip and thread some beads onto it. The colours can match the watch face, or you could even have different straps for different occasions or outfits.

How about having an antique style brushed copper watch face, combined with a deep brown faux suede strap. You could have a double strap for more security and style, and you'll be able to put more decoration on it too. Slip on some wooden beads or antique copper beads and have them spread out so that you can move them around if you like, but so that it isn't too crowded with beads.

You'll be able to wear it all summer, as the browns reflect the earthen, natural colours, and in winter as its dark, antique style fits with longer coats and warmer jumpers.
